Section 2: Why Most Businesses Remain Invisible
Many businesses fail online not because they lack great products, but because they misunderstand the rules of digital attention. Here are the main reasons:
Mistake 1: Lack of a Clear Magnetic Message
If your audience can’t immediately understand what you offer or why it matters, they scroll past. Generic statements like
“We sell the best products” don’t cut it.
Step by Step Fix
- Identify your Unique Selling Proposition (USP)
- Craft a concise tagline that communicates your value clearly
- Test it: if someone can’t explain your business in 10 seconds, it’s too vague

Mistake 2: Neglecting Storytelling
Humans are wired for stories, not features or specifications. Without storytelling, your brand feels cold, distant, and forgettable.
Step by Step Fix
- Share the origin story of your business
- Use customer stories and testimonials as mini narratives
- Break down complex ideas into relatable short form stories
Example: A small bakery doesn’t just sell cupcakes. They post stories of their head baker testing new flavors, customer celebrations, and behind the scenes chaos. Followers feel part of the journey, not just consumers.
Mistake 3: Misunderstanding Your Audience
Many businesses create content blindly instead of speaking directly to their ideal audience. Broad messages attract minimal attention.
Step by Step Fix
- Build customer avatars
- Track where your audience spends time online
- Tailor content to solve their problems
Tip: Use surveys, social media polls, or website analytics to validate assumptions. Mistake 4: Inconsistency
Posting sporadically is like setting up a store, then locking it randomly. Audiences forget you exist if you’re not consistently present and valuable.
Step by Step Fix
- Develop a content calendar
- Focus on 2 to 3 platforms
- Mix educational, entertaining, and promotional content

3. Optimize for Search Engines
SEO remains one of the most cost effective ways to get attention. Businesses that dominate online often rank for high intent keywords attracting leads without paid ads.
Step by Step Fix
- Conduct keyword research
- Write content that answers audience questions
- Include internal links guiding readers deeper into your funnel
